What is the purpose of this trial?

This trial collects blood, DNA, and tissue samples from individuals with tuberous sclerosis complex (TSC) or sporadic lymphangioleiomyomatosis (LAM). The goal is to create a repository that aids researchers in studying how these conditions affect health over a lifetime. Participants' samples link to a database that tracks their health history to understand the long-term impact of these diseases. Individuals diagnosed with TSC or LAM might be suitable candidates. As an unphased study, this trial offers participants the chance to contribute to valuable research that could enhance understanding and treatment of these conditions.

Timeline for a Trial Participant

Screening

Participants are screened for eligibility to participate in the trial

Biosample Collection

Collection of blood, tissues, and cells from individuals with TSC at various locations including clinical study sites, participant's homes, or educational meetings

Ongoing

Data Collection

Collection of retrospective and prospective clinical data on individuals with TSC over their lifespan

Average 15 years

Follow-up

Participants are monitored for the impact of TSC on their health over their lifetime

Ongoing
